Provides rides for only the following purposes: medical appointments. Also, you must meet at least one of these criteria: you are 60+ years old. No membership is required.
Dignified Senior Transportation is a versatile transportation program designed to cater to the diverse needs of older adults. This non-emergency medical transportation service offers a range of options, including transportation via taxi, public transit like buses or trains, and private car rides. The program operates on an hourly rate basis and accommodates various payment methods such as insurance, vouchers, coupons, donations, Medicaid, checks, credit cards, or cash.
Riders are encouraged to schedule their trips in advance, with flexibility ranging from next-day to several days or even weeks ahead of time. The program ensures affordability by requesting a nominal donation of $0.51 per mile, which goes towards covering volunteer service costs, although lack of funds does not preclude individuals from accessing the service. Additionally, riders can benefit from unique features such as assistance with packages, door-to-door or curb-to-curb transportation, and the option to have a driver wait during appointments or errands.
With a commitment to inclusivity, Dignified Senior Transportation welcomes service animals on board and provides paratransit services for those with mobility challenges. Whether older adults require a quick taxi ride, a fixed-route bus service, or a shared van trip, this program aims to meet their transportation needs effectively and reliably.
Service Area
Transportation available throughoutSheboygan County with limited service into surrounding counties.
